    LESSON PLAN - PET

    LESSON 1

    1. Present the test (parts, duration, level, marking), the classes, the book and the mocks.

    2. Explain the first part of the speaking test and have students ask some questions to each other. Review thealphabet, making sure everybody can spell their second names and surnames. Make them spell some words and

    focus on the hardest letters:

    AEIAIEIEAIEAEI GJJGJGJGGJ QKKQKQQKQKQK

    Have the students choose pictures and describe them to one another.

    This picture shows I can also see and It looks like The people/man/child seems to be happy/sad

    because I believe he/she/they are

    3. Introduce Reading Part 1 using the exercises in the extra book, which the students have to do in pairs. Correct

    with the whole class and then have them do one complete exercise of this part individually. Correct by indicating

    what they did wrong and asking them to redo these ones.

    4. Grammar: Suggestions.

    - Explain on the board.

    - Practice orally, in pairs, using the photographs.

    - Do the exercises in the Extra Book.

    5. Have a listening marathonof Parts 1 and 2, using the extra book.

    6. Practice Speaking Part 4. Provide feedback.

    7. Explain the Writing Part 2 and give some good examples. Ask students to write their own texts and correct

    individually, providing feedback. It can be assigned as homework.

    PET PART 1 QUESTIONS

    1)

    Do you think English will be useful for you in the future?

    2)

    Do you like to study English?3)

    Tell us about your job.

    4)

    What do you usually do at weekends?

    5)

    How did you celebrate your last birthday?

    6)

    What did you do yesterday?

    7)

    What are you going to do this weekend?

    8)

    What kind of books do you like to read?9) How often do you use the internet?

    10)How much free time do you have every week?
